Variety description

10 August 2026

The plant has a shorter and stiffer straw compared to the parent form Gros Bleu. The ear is long, medium-compact, and has a milky-white hue. The grain is large, yellow in color, blunt in shape, and is characterized by good test weight.

The variety possesses high baking qualities. In phytopathological studies, Bon Fermier was historically used as a reference differential variety for the identification of yellow rust pathogen races.
